Hensarling: Court Ruling Means Executive Orders Now Apply to CFPB

| Posted in Press Releases

House Financial Services Committee Chairman Jeb Hensarling (R-TX) notified CFPB Director Richard Cordray in a letter today that a recent federal court ruling means the Bureau must now follow executive orders requiring agencies to ensure the benefits of their proposed regulations outweigh the costs.
